⚙️ NGINX Основные команды
#nginx #install #web #server
---- install nginx
#dotnet
#nginx #install #web #server
---- install nginx
apt install nginx -y---- base comands
systemctl enable nginx
nginx -s stop
— быстрое завершениеnginx -s quit
— плавное завершениеnginx -s reload
— перезагрузка конфигурационного файлаnginx -s reopen
— переоткрытие лог-файловsystemctl restart nginx---- default config /etc/nginx/nginx.conf
#dotnet
user www-data;
worker_processes auto;
pid /run/nginx.pid;
include /etc/nginx/modules-enabled/*.conf;
events {}
http {
server {
listen 80;
location / {
proxy_pass http://localhost:5000;
}
}
}
#frontendserver {
listen 80;
server_name mysite.com;
charset utf-8;
root /var/www/mysite-folder;
index index.html index.htm;
location / {
root /var/www/mysite-folder;
try_files $uri /index.html;
}
}